Red Flags and Suspicious Behavior

Several red flags are associated with unlicensed brokers like Aparthy. These include false promises of unusually high returns, pressure to invest quickly without proper research, and shady practices such as not allowing withdrawals or ignoring customer service requests. Unlicensed brokers often use fake credentials or claim to be regulated by non-existent or fake regulatory bodies. It’s essential for potential investors to be cautious of such behaviors and thoroughly research any investment opportunity before committing funds.

Tips for Identifying Unlicensed Brokers

To avoid falling prey to investment scams, it’s crucial to know how to spot an unlicensed broker. Here are some tips:

  • Research Thoroughly: Always research the broker’s reputation online, looking for reviews and any past scam reports.
  • Check for Licenses: Verify if the broker is licensed by a legitimate regulatory body. Check the regulator’s website to confirm the broker’s license status.
  • Be Wary of Unrealistic Promises: If an investment seems too good to be true, it probably is. Be cautious of unusually high returns with "guaranteed" success.
  • Look for Physical Address: Legitimate brokers usually have a physical address listed on their website. Be wary of brokers with only a PO box or no address at all.

Steps to Take After Falling for a Scam

If you’ve fallen victim to an unlicensed broker or investment scam, here are crucial steps to take:

  1. Stop All Communication: Immediately cease all communication with the scammer to prevent further loss.
  2. Report the Scam: Inform relevant authorities, such as your local police department and financial regulatory bodies, about the scam. Reporting helps prevent others from falling victim to the same scam.
  3. Contact Your Bank or Payment Provider: Notify your bank or payment provider about the unauthorized transactions. They may be able to reverse the charges or provide additional security measures.
  4. Consider Identity Theft Protection: If you’ve shared personal or financial information, consider signing up for identity theft protection services to monitor your accounts and credit reports.
  5. Warn Others: Share your experience through reviews and on scam reporting websites to help others avoid similar scams.
